January 21, 1910

history

Angel Island Immigration Station Opens

The Angel Island Immigration Station opened in San Francisco Bay; often called the 'Ellis Island of the West,' it processed-and, under the exclusion laws, often detained and interrogated-hundreds of thousands of Asian immigrants until 1940.
